Where I work in South Australia ... it's $5,000 with whatever brackets you choose.

We recommend upper six ceramics and the rest metal. More and more we're being asked for all ceramic, which the patient can have, as long as the bite will not put the teeth at risk of 'banging' on a ceramic bracket.

It's tough to figure out what a "standard" cost should be, since the cost of the actual brackets is not the major part of the cost of treatment. Major factors that need to be included are difficulty/length of treatment, location, and the orthodontist .

$5,000 for ceramic self ligating brackets - top AND bottom.
I live in northern NJ very close to NY state border. (I'm about 20 miles outside of New York City.)

(In my case ceramics on bottom is permitted as there is NO danger of my bottom teeth hitting the tops because I have an open bite.)

Treatment time will be 24 months. Being treated for anterior open bite, posterior cross bite and some crowding of top and bottom teeth. I've had one ortho (with like 35 yrs experience) tell me I'm a 'challenging' case and said he'd have to charge me for it. He also charged me $600 the day of my consult for xrays and molds and when I returend for my treatment plan he quoted me $8,000 for ceramic on top only and for his experience and skill.

Most other orthos told me I was not an excessively challenging case and actually quite textbook.

The ortho I chose took xrays and molds the day of my consult free of charge. I returned for treatment plan and the $5,000 includes everything - all appointments, as well as treatment to maintain my teeth after I am de-braced, forever. (He also uses several of the popular brands of brackets GAC and 3M and a variety of archwire brands based on the patient to include Damon.)

That all being said - for me, price is not an issue. And had the ortho I've ultimately chosen charged me $8,000 or more, I would have paid it. That is how much I trust him and his expertise!
